iommufd: Disallow allocating nested parent domain with fault ID

Allocating a domain with a fault ID indicates that the domain is faultable.
However, there is a gap for the nested parent domain to support PRI. Some
hardware lacks the capability to distinguish whether PRI occurs at stage 1
or stage 2. This limitation may require software-based page table walking
to resolve. Since no in-tree IOMMU driver currently supports this
functionality, it is disallowed. For more details, refer to the related
discussion at [1].

@@ -126,6 +126,9 @@ iommufd_hwpt_paging_alloc(struct iommufd_ctx *ictx, struct iommufd_ioas *ioas,
	if ((flags & IOMMU_HWPT_ALLOC_DIRTY_TRACKING) &&
	    !device_iommu_capable(idev->dev, IOMMU_CAP_DIRTY_TRACKING))
		return ERR_PTR(-EOPNOTSUPP);
	if ((flags & IOMMU_HWPT_FAULT_ID_VALID) &&
	    (flags & IOMMU_HWPT_ALLOC_NEST_PARENT))
		return ERR_PTR(-EOPNOTSUPP);

	hwpt_paging = __iommufd_object_alloc(
		ictx, hwpt_paging, IOMMUFD_OBJ_HWPT_PAGING, common.obj);
